Temecula, June 5, 2025 -

A traffic collision occurred today on Rancho California Road in Temecula, CA, involving two vehicles: a silver Ram 1500 and a dark gray full-size Dodge truck. The incident was reported around 5:17 PM, with one vehicle found down an embankment, prompting a swift emergency response.

Multiple emergency units were dispatched to manage the scene and regulate traffic flow. Towing services were requested for at least one vehicle that was off the road, indicating the need for removal to clear the area. As a result of the collision, lane management and traffic control measures were implemented, leading to significant traffic impact on the affected stretch of Rancho California Road.

Motorists experienced delays and congestion as emergency responders worked to secure the scene. Reports indicated that there were multiple near-collisions due to the backup, highlighting the need for caution in the area.

By approximately 6:45 PM, traffic control measures were in place to help alleviate the situation, and the roadway was confirmed cleared by 7:01 PM. However, drivers are advised to remain vigilant and expect potential residual delays as cleanup efforts conclude.
